Key Components of Liposuction After Care

1. Immediate Post-Surgery Care

Right after liposuction, patients are usually monitored for several hours to ensure stability. During this phase, healthcare providers focus on pain relief, preventing bleeding, and managing anesthesia effects. Once discharged, the focus shifts to maintaining comfort and supporting healing.

2. Wearing Compression Garments: The Foundation of Effective Recovery

Compression garments are vital for liposuction after care. These specially designed elastic clothing provide essential support to the treated areas, helping to reduce swelling, improve contouring, and prevent fluid accumulation. It's crucial to wear these garments as prescribed, typically for 2 to 6 weeks, to optimize healing and results.

3. Managing Swelling, Bruising, and Discomfort

Swelling and bruising are common following liposuction. To manage these symptoms effectively:

  • Elevate the treated areas whenever possible to promote fluid drainage.
  • Apply cold compresses intermittently to reduce swelling and minimize discomfort.
  • Take prescribed pain medications as directed, and consider over-the-counter options like acetaminophen for mild pain.
  • Stay well-hydrated and avoid salt-rich foods to help reduce fluid retention.

5. Activity and Movement Guidelines

While rest is important initially, gentle movement stimulates circulation and prevents blood clots. Typically, light walking is encouraged within a day or two after surgery. Strenuous activities and intense exercise should be avoided for at least 2 to 4 weeks, or until the physician approves.

6. Wound Care and Infection Prevention

Proper wound management is essential for liposuction after care. Keep the incision sites clean and dry, follow your surgeon’s instructions about dressing changes, and watch for signs of infection, such as increased redness, swelling, pus, or fever. Early intervention prevents complications and promotes optimal healing.

Common Challenges and How to Overcome Them

While most patients experience smooth recovery, some may face challenges such as persistent swelling, irregular contours, or minor infections.

Managing Unanticipated Post-Operative Issues

  • Persistent swelling: Usually resolves within a few weeks. Compression garments and massage can aid recovery.
  • Irregular contours or asymmetry: May require minor corrections or massage therapy under your surgeon’s guidance.
  • Infections or wound issues: Immediate medical attention is essential to prevent complications.
